Neill Blomkamp outlines next sci-fi project
Story by Jack Foley
NEILL Blomkamp, the director behind breakout smash District 9, has begun work on his next science fiction movie and has been given complete creative control.
The as-yet untitled project will start shooting midway through 2010 but Blomkamp is already hard at work on the script and visual effects, according to Variety.
It will also be completed without any assistance from Peter Jackson, who was instrumental in guiding Blomkamp through the ropes on District 9.
Commenting on his hopes for the film, Blomkamp told Variety: “Hopefully, this will be a bit unique, very much a reflection of me. It is absolutely another science fiction film, quite different from District 9, but some of the blending of genres and the tone might be within the same realm.”
The in-demand director also confirmed that he will be making a sequel to District 9 with Sony Pictures, although the new and unrelated project will be his next directing assignment.
